Unlike Facebook, Instagram, or Twitter, LinkedIn is specifically marketed as a communication platform for professionals and offers highly targeted opportunities to reach other professionals in the markets that you care most about. The platform allows users to create personal and business profiles to communicate with future employers, create B2B connections, or promote a business. LinkedIn is a specialized social media platform and, used in more than 200 countries and territories worldwide, the world’s largest professional network. When you’re ready to create a LinkedIn Page for your organization, make sure you’re logged into LinkedIn, then click the Work icon in the top right corner of the LinkedIn homepage. These LinkedIn Page requirements are in place to stop people impersonating your nonprofit on the platform. You’ll also need to list a work email address featuring your nonprofit’s unique email domain, rather than your personal email address. To create a LinkedIn Page for your nonprofit, you first need to have a personal account that includes your name and current position at your organization. This also means that whenever someone lists employment, volunteer, and board experience at your organization on LinkedIn, your nonprofit’s logo and a link to its LinkedIn Page will automatically appear on their profile. By creating a LinkedIn Page, you can showcase your nonprofit as an organization, helping to build credibility. This is a little different than the LinkedIn profile you have as an individual, which is designed to help you manage your personal professional brand.
